Sporting Kansas City is a professional soccer club based in Kansas City, Missouri, and a charter member of Major League Soccer. Founded in 1996, the organization is locally owned by five Kansas City entrepreneurs: the Patterson Family, Cliff Illig, Robb Heineman, Greg Maday, and Pat Curran. The club plays at Sporting Park, which opened in 2011. The organization operates across five functional areas: operations (stadium and venue management), marketing and fan engagement, sports (coaching and player development), design, and sales. Current initiatives include youth soccer programming, event activations at partner venues, stadium feature upgrades, and a legacy loyalty program rebuild.
Sporting KC uses Salesforce (CRM and Marketing Cloud), Adobe Creative Cloud (Premiere Pro, Workfront), Google Ads, Microsoft Office suite, Tableau, Power BI, Meta Ads Manager, and mobile platforms (iOS, Android).
